Plain-English summary
CVE-2022-2263 is an SQL injection issue in Online Hotel Booking System 1.0. A privileged remote user can manipulate the roomname argument in the room category edit function, potentially affecting limited database confidentiality, integrity, and availability. Public exploit details exist, but the provided sources do not show active exploitation or a vendor patch.

Technical view
The issue affects edit_room_cat.php in the Room Handler component of Online Hotel Booking System 1.0. The roomname parameter is reported to reach SQL handling unsafely, mapped to CWE-89. CVSS 3.1 is 4.7 because exploitation is remote and low complexity but requires high privileges, with low C/I/A impact.
Likely exposure
Exposure is likely limited to organizations running Online Hotel Booking System 1.0, especially if the administrative room-management interface is reachable over the internet. Risk is higher where privileged accounts are shared, weakly protected, or exposed after credential compromise.
Exploitation context
The source bundle says exploit information has been publicly disclosed and may be used. It does not cite CISA KEV inclusion or any confirmed active exploitation. The CVSS vector indicates an attacker needs high privileges, so this is mainly a post-authentication application risk.

Mitigation direction
- Inventory any Online Hotel Booking System 1.0 deployments.
- Restrict access to administrative room-management pages.
- Check vendor or project guidance for fixed releases or advisories.
- If maintaining code, use parameterized queries for roomname handling.
- Review privileged account hygiene and enforce strong authentication.
Validation and detection
- Confirm whether Online Hotel Booking System 1.0 is deployed.
- Check whether edit_room_cat.php exists and is reachable.
- Review code paths handling the roomname parameter.
- Review logs for SQL errors or suspicious room-category edits.
- Verify privileged access controls around Room Handler functions.
